According to the World Christian Encyclopedia: A comparative survey of churches and religions , Christianity is the largest religion in the world with 33% (2.1 billion followers) of the world's population expressing a minimal level of self-identification adherents of Christianity.
Islam is the 2nd largest religion with 21% (1.3 billion followers), followed by Secular/Non-Religious/Atheist/Agnostic people making up 16% (1.1 billion) of the world's population.
The other classical religions follow with Hinduism having 14% (900 million), traditional Chinese religions having 6% (394 million) and Buddhism having 6% (376 million) followers respectively.
